Users Manual

QUICK START GUIDE For a full explanation of all features and instructions, please refer to the User’s Guide (available for download from support.hubbleconnected.com). 1. Setting up your Smart Bluetooth Baby Scale A. Install battery The battery operates with 4 AAA alkaline batteries type LR03 (1.5V). 1. Turn the weighing scale bottom up to locate the battery compartment, open the battery door to install the batteries provided as the fi gure shown. 2. Install four (4) new “AAA” batteries (LR03) into the battery compartment according to the polarity markings inside. 3. Replace the battery cover after insert the batteries. 4. Press the Power ON/OFF 0 button to turn on the weighing scale. Note: • Batteries are to be installed with the correct polarity. • Do not mix batteries of different types or mix old and new batteries, replace all 4 batteries when empty with new batteries. • If the scale is to be stored unused for a long period of time, the batteries should be removed. • The battery contacts are not to be short-circuited. Model: Hubble Grow US EN B. Set up HubbleClub by Hubble Connect App to track your baby’s growth • Scan the QR code with your smart device and download HubbleClub by Hubble Connected App from the App Store for iOS devices or from the Google Play™ Store for Android™ devices. • Install HubbleClub by Hubble Connected App on your device. • Open the HubbleClub by Hubble Connected App on your compatible smartphone or tablet. • Turn on Bluetooth of your compatible smartphone or tablet. • Follow the in-app instructions to create your Hubble account and connect to your device. Note: Please take note of the following minimum system requirements: Smartphones/Tablets: iOS 10.0, Android™ 7.0, Bluetooth 4.2. 2. Overview of the control panel 4 12 5 3 1. LCD Display Bluetooth Signal Memory symbol Flashes when the memory is full. Weight Change indicator The symbol appears together with the Memory symbol to show weight value change with Up arrow (weight gain) or Down arrow (weight loss) indications. 2. Power ON/OFF button 0 3. UNIT button Select the unit of measurement: kilograms (kg) or pounds (lb). 4. TARE button Reset the scale to zero reading. 5. HOLD button If the baby is moving, press the Hold button to lock in the correct weight. Once you pressed, the data will be stored. Press HOLD while the baby is on the platform alone and still, so the machine stabilises the detected weight (it will flash on the screen). When the display stops flashing, the weight of the baby will be displayed alternating with the up/down difference from the last weight. 3. Using the baby scale 3.1 Turn On/Off the baby scale Press the Power ON/OFF 0 button to turn On/Off the weighing scale. 3.2 Select Weighing Unit Press the UNIT button on the control panel to select unit of measurement, kilograms (kg) or pounds (lb). 3.3 Tare Weight The function is to reset the scale's display to zero. When you measure your baby together with the soft pad, you don't want to include the soft pad weight in the reading. 1. To tare the soft pad, place it on scale, wait for a stable reading. 2. Press the TARE button to reset the display to zero, the digit “” is displayed. 3.4 Baby Weighing 1. Press Power ON/OFF 0 button to turn on the baby scale, when the digits “” are displayed, the machine is ready for weighing. 2. Place your baby on the weighing scale until the weight reading steadily appears on the display. 3. Press the HOLD button to lock and store the data. The data is transmitted to HubblClub app when smart device and scale are in sync. 3.5 Weight Tracker The scale tracks the weight change between current and last measurements. The display shows the current weight and the weight difference (between the current weight and the last weight) alternately. Each weight displays for 2s. Scale will turn off automatically after 8s. (Note: In the fi rst use after installing the batteries, the display will only show the current weight, then turn off automatically after 8s.) Fig.1 - The symbol indicates it is weight lose against last reading. Fig.2 - The symbol indicates it is weight gain against last reading. Fig.3 - No weight change was detected (Fig.3). Note: In the fi rst use after installing the batteries, the display will only show the current weight. The weight data will not be kept whenever the batteries are replaced.
